Understanding the Check Engine Light

The check engine light (CEL) is part of your vehicle’s onboard diagnostics system. It can illuminate for various reasons, ranging from minor issues to significant problems that may require immediate attention. Here’s what you need to know:

  • Indicates a problem with the engine or emissions system.
  • Can be triggered by a loose gas cap or a faulty sensor.
  • May require a diagnostic scan to identify the specific issue.

Common Reasons for the Check Engine Light

Several factors can cause the check engine light to activate. Understanding these can help you determine the urgency of the situation:

  • Loose or Damaged Gas Cap: This is one of the most common reasons for a CEL. Ensure your gas cap is tight and undamaged.
  • Faulty Oxygen Sensor: This sensor monitors the exhaust gases and helps manage fuel efficiency. A malfunction can trigger the light.
  • Catalytic Converter Issues: Problems with the catalytic converter can affect emissions and engine performance.
  • Mass Airflow Sensor Problems: This sensor measures the amount of air entering the engine and can cause performance issues if faulty.
  • Ignition System Failures: Issues with spark plugs or ignition coils can lead to misfires, triggering the CEL.

How to Respond When the Check Engine Light Comes On

When your check engine light illuminates, it’s essential to take appropriate steps to diagnose the issue:

  • Stay Calm: Not all check engine light activations indicate a severe problem.
  • Check for Obvious Issues: Inspect your gas cap and look for any visible leaks or issues.
  • Use an OBD-II Scanner: This tool can read the diagnostic trouble codes (DTCs) stored in your vehicle’s computer.
  • Consult Your Owner’s Manual: Your manual may provide insights into the specific codes and recommended actions.
  • Seek Professional Help: If the light remains on or you notice performance issues, visit a qualified mechanic.

Using an OBD-II Scanner

Using an OBD-II scanner can help you identify the specific issue causing your check engine light to activate. Here’s how to use one:

  • Purchase or Borrow an OBD-II Scanner: These devices are widely available and easy to use.
  • Locate the OBD-II Port: In most Subarus, this port is found under the dashboard near the driver’s seat.
  • Connect the Scanner: Plug the scanner into the OBD-II port and turn on the ignition.
  • Read the Codes: Follow the scanner’s instructions to retrieve the trouble codes.
  • Interpret the Codes: Use the scanner’s manual or an online database to understand the codes and their meanings.

Common OBD-II Codes for Subaru Vehicles

Here are some common OBD-II codes you might encounter as a Subaru owner:

  • P0420: Catalyst System Efficiency Below Threshold (Bank 1)
  • P0131: Oxygen Sensor Circuit Low Voltage (Bank 1 Sensor 1)
  • P0301: Cylinder 1 Misfire Detected
  • P0171: System Too Lean (Bank 1)
  • P0442: Evaporative Emission Control System Leak Detected (Small Leak)

When to Seek Professional Help

While some check engine light issues can be resolved at home, others require professional attention. Consider seeking help from a mechanic if:

  • The check engine light is flashing.
  • You notice a significant drop in engine performance.
  • There are unusual noises coming from the engine.
  • You see smoke or smell unusual odors while driving.
  • The light remains on after addressing potential issues.
